The Mandalorian press site revealed the identity of Werner Herzog’s character in the upcoming Star Wars series.

The Star Wars franchise is set to expand with the release of The Mandalorian, a new series produced for Disney’s upcoming streaming service. Set in between the events of Star Wars: Return of the Jedi and Star Wars: The Force Awakens, the series will introduce several newcomers to the universe, including a mysterious character played by acclaimed German filmmaker Werner Herzog.

Of course, details on Werner Herzog’s character remain a mystery, though previews for the Star Wars series reveal he will have significant contact with the eponymous Mandalorian. Now, an official press site for The Mandalorian includes a photo of Werner Herzog’s character that credits the filmmaker-turned-actor as “The Client.”

Here is the official synopsis for The Mandalorian:

After the stories of Jango and Boba Fett, another warrior emerges in the Star Wars universe. The Mandalorian is set after the fall of the Empire and before the emergence of the First Order. We follow the travails of a lone gunfighter in the outer reaches of the galaxy far from the authority of the New Republic.

The Mandalorian stars Pedro Pascal, Gina Carano, Giancarlo Esposito, Emily Swallow, Carl Weathers, Omid Abtahi, Werner Herzog, and Nick Nolte. The series was written by Jon Favreau, who also serves as an executive producer alongside Dave Filoni, Kathleen Kennedy, and Colin Wilson. Karen Gilchrist is also on board as a co-executive producer.

Dave Filoni will direct the first episode of the series and additional episodes will be helmed by Thor: Ragnarok director Taika Waititi, Jurassic World star Bryce Dallas Howard, Dope director Rick Famuyiwa, and Jessica Jones director Deborah Chow.

The Mandalorian will premiere exclusively on Disney Plus on November 12, 2019.
